The structure of the O-polysaccharide of an aerobic halophilic bacterium Salinicola salarius HO-14 isolated from a heavy oil reservoir with highly mineralized water was determined. The neutral O-polysaccharide of strain HO-14 was isolated from the lipopolysaccharide and studied by sugar analysis and NMR spectroscopy. The linear tetrasaccharide repeating unit was found to have the following structure: →2)-α-l-Rhap-(1 → 3)-β-l-Rhap-(1 → 2)-α-l-Rhap-(1 → 2)-α-d-Manp-(1→.
